S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

Comprehensive architecture blueprint generation from codebases to ensure architectural clarity, documentation, and maintainability.

Core Features & Use Cases

  • Auto-detect technology stacks and architectural patterns across codebases
  • Generate visual diagrams and documentation for architectural decisions
  • Provide extensible blueprints and templates to guide development and enforce architectural consistency
  • Use Case: teams migrating to microservices or complex monoliths can automatically map components and capture ADRs
